    Eh, anonymity is great for some things, less so in others.

    But burner emails are pretty much as anonymous as it gets on the fediverse. If you pick a random user name and cycle to a new account fairly often, you’re anonymous to other users. A VPN mostly anonymizes you from the instances.

    Being real though, that’s kinda dickish to the instances because you’re wasting the tiny bit of resources used to create accounts. If you do it often enough to really anonymize, it adds up.

  • It would be possible to set up an instance where users could post as guests, ie everyone who did that would appear as the same user, something like anon@lemmychan.social.

    It is also likely that such accounts would soon be banned in many places because people will use them to post unwanted posts and comments.

    Anonymity relies on other people using the same name. Otherwise you’ve just got pseudonymity, like me right now.

    You can get the same end result with throwaways, but it’s a bit more time-taking on most instances since spammers have abused most of the instances without a signup manual approval.
